How to fill out offering an in-service
How to fill out offering an in-service
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information about the in-service you are offering. This may include the topic, date, time, location, and any prerequisites or requirements.
02
Create a clear and concise description of the in-service. Make sure to highlight the benefits and goals of attending the in-service.
03
Determine the target audience for the in-service. This will help you tailor the content and delivery methods to their specific needs and interests.
04
Develop an agenda or outline for the in-service. Break it down into different sections or modules and specify the time allocated for each.
05
Decide on the format of the in-service. Will it be a presentation, workshop, or interactive session? Consider the best approach based on the topic and audience.
06
Prepare any necessary materials or resources for the in-service. This may include handouts, slides, videos, or activities.
07
Promote the in-service through various channels such as emails, newsletters, social media, or direct invitations. Clearly communicate the registration process and any fees or requirements.
08
Collect registrations and manage attendee information. You can use online registration forms or other tools to streamline this process.
09
Prior to the in-service, make sure all logistical arrangements are in place. This includes reserving the venue, arranging audiovisual equipment, and confirming any guest speakers or facilitators.
10
On the day of the in-service, welcome attendees and provide them with any necessary materials or instructions. Deliver the content according to the agenda and engage participants through interactive activities or discussions.
11
After the in-service, gather feedback from attendees to evaluate the effectiveness and make improvements for future offerings. Thank participants for their attendance and provide any follow-up resources or materials.
